One of Gold Care’s most popular homes, Baugh House is located in Sidcup, Kent. The home is conveniently located off Sidcup High Street, while still offering a rural location. With stunning views of the surrounding countryside and the Foots Cray Meadows, which together offer a beautiful tranquil setting. Baugh House offers the best of both worlds, of a rural setting while still close to high street stores, local pub, supermarket and a selection of independent shops offering a mix of eclectic goods.

“It’s what’s inside that counts” is true of all Gold Care Homes' and specifically what people love about Baugh House. The Care team and other support teams in the home are the heart of the business. Baugh House has long-standing staff who are devoted to caring and creating a friendly, fun, home-like atmosphere for their residents. Support you may be entitled to

If you chose a care home based in England, you may be eligible for NHS Funded Nursing Care (FNC), which helps cover the cost of nursing. This is worth £254.06 per week and is usually paid directly to the care home.

Overall Experience 2.0 out of 5
I find this difficult to write as my father has been asked to leave. He’s 82 and has been there for 4 years so is very settled. Baugh House had already contacted authorities above social services before telling me. The home selection team have been looking for homes with difficulty. They contacted one
and the manager went to visit my dad. No one told me this was happening. No contact from Baugh House at all to let me know. I have spoken to this manager and she was shocked to hear he was being made to move. I used to receive calls with incidents but haven’t had a call for a long time so was surprised to hear he was being asked to leave. This is going to be a horrendous move for my dad and his vascular dementia is bad now. How can they do this to an 82-year-old man? We were told they wouldn’t supply one-to-one yet when I visited he was receiving one-to-one. He just wants company. They have no idea the stress this causes a family let alone the resident.

Review from Michelle W (Daughter of Resident) published on 5 May 2022 Submitted via Website • Report
Overall Experience 2.0 out of 5
My father had been a resident for nearly 4 years at Baugh House! The permanent carers were super with continuity for my father's dementia needs, this we couldn’t fault, but the management are awful! Not a single manager remained for more than a few months at a time. There was over frequent use of agency
staff to the detriment to the residents! Management was always full of empty promises of improvement but alas with a week's notice in November 2021 we were informed my father had to leave! We were informed that his care needs were too great but this was a lie as his DST had not changed since he moved in, then we were informed this was not the case and that it was funding! This sent our family into a frantic search for a new home! the management put undue stress on our family and to the disgust of the carers that looked after my father we had to find a new home. This resulted in many of the long-term caring staff leaving. Please think carefully when choosing this home! Management are awful!

Current Review Score: 9.7 (9.731)

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.7 (9.731) out of 10 for Baugh House is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  1. The Average Rating is 4.7 out of 5 from 32 Reviews in the last 24 months.
  2. The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 31 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.731 for Baugh House is calculated as follows: ( (292 Excellents x 5) + (73 Goods x 4) + (4 Satisfactorys x 3) + (4 Poors x 2) + (2 Very Poors x 1) ) ÷ 375 Ratings = 4.731
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5'). The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Baugh House is based on 31 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    1. 4 points are available for the first 20 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ews, 0.05 Points for the next five Positive Reviews, and finally 0.025 Points for the next ten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.050, 7th = 0.050, 8th = 0.050, 9th = 0.050, 10th = 0.050, 11th = 0.025, 12th = 0.025, 13th = 0.025, 14th = 0.025, 15th = 0.025, 16th = 0.025, 17th = 0.025, 18th = 0.025, 19th = 0.025, 20th = 0.025)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.05 + 0.05 + 0.05 + 0.05 + 0.05 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 + 0.025 = 4
    2. 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 60 registered maximum number of service users is 12, which has been reached with 31 Positive reviews. Points = 1
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
